Why did Jimi Hendrix play last at Woodstock?

By 1969, Hendrix was a major star who had earned the traditional headliner’s position: playing last. Technical and weather delays caused the festival to stretch into Monday morning. The organizers had given Hendrix the opportunity to go on at midnight, but he opted to be the closer.

How do I sound like Jimi Hendrix?

Fuzz and wah-wah are the two main effects that you need to sound like Jimi Hendrix. But beyond those, it is also worth considering a Uni-Vibe pedal. In the later stages of his career, Hendrix really got into Uni-Vibe, using it to great effect on songs like Star Spangled Banner, Machine Gun and Izabella.

Did Jimi Hendrix sing the Star-Spangled Banner at Woodstock?

Recorded live at the Woodstock Festival on August 18, 1969, this album includes Hendrix’s famous “Star-Spangled Banner” and documents his stunning performance that closed the most iconic music festival in history.

Would Jimi Hendrix have played “Star Spangled Banner” without Jimi Morrison?

Hendrix undoubtedly would have played “Star Spangled Banner” with or without Morrison’s prodding, as the anthem had become a fixture on The Jimi Hendrix Experience’s concert setlist since August 1968.
